amb marge

“amb marge” — with a margin in Catalan. Phrase, level B1. Literally "with a margin": the margin is the spare room. We came to the station with a margin: the train was ten minutes late. In a live sentence: “Hem arribat a l'estació amb marge: el tren tardava deu minuts” — We came to the station with a margin: the train was ten minutes late.
